Latest Patents

Yoon's latest patents include a vacuum insulation panel, a refrigerator equipped with a vacuum insulation panel, and a manufacturing method for the vacuum insulation panel. The vacuum insulation panel features a core material with a bending groove on at least one surface, covered by an envelope material that protects both the outer surface of the core and the inner surface of the bending groove. Additionally, he has developed a vacuum insulation member, which includes a core with a specific shape and a decompressed space, along with a gas barrier layer that ensures impermeability. This innovation allows for the elimination of the need for an envelope film, enhancing reliability and reducing the complexity of the manufacturing process.
